About the Role
We’re looking for a highly organised, proactive People Operations Associate who can also serve as an Office Manager/Coordinator. This hybrid role sits at the intersection of HR, employee experience, and office operations, with responsibility for supporting employees across both our New York and Austin locations. You’ll play a key role in shaping a cohesive, inclusive culture across offices while ensuring our workspace runs smoothly.

Key Responsibilities


People Operations (HR)

• Support the full employee lifecycle across New York and Austin: onboarding, offboarding, and transitions

• Maintain accurate employee records and HR systems (HRIS updates, documentation, compliance tracking)

• Assist with benefits administration and respond to employee inquiries

• Drive employee engagement initiatives across offices

• Ensure compliance with federal, New York, and Texas employment laws and policies

• Support recruiting coordination (interview scheduling, candidate communication across time zones)

Office Management & Coordination

• Oversee daily operations of the New York office, ensuring a productive and welcoming environment

• Act as the primary point of contact for Austin employees’ operational needs, coordinating remotely with vendors and partners as needed

• Manage office vendors, supplies, and services (facilities, catering, etc.)

• Coordinate in-office and cross-office events, team gatherings, and company meetings

• Maintain office organisation and space planning

• Support health & safety compliance and workplace policies across both locations

Culture & Employee Experience

• Help foster a unified, inclusive culture across our workforce

• Plan and execute engagement activities that connect teams

• Act as a go-to resource for employee questions, ensuring consistent support regardless of location

We’re Looking For

• Experience in People Operations, HR, Office Management, or similar role

• Strong organisational and multitasking skills with high attention to detail

• Excellent interpersonal and communication skills

• Ability to handle sensitive information with discretion and professionalism

• Familiarity with HRIS platforms

• Knowledge of New York and Texas labor laws is a strong advantage

• Proactive, resourceful, and comfortable operating across different time zones and working in a fast paced environment
